<< Ok so you have finally made it official you have joined the anti Clinton group>>

I have always made my position regarding Clinton very clear - I disagree with most of his positions, but give him a fair amount of credit for keeping the Republican legislation close to the middle of the political spectrum. I have also said I would like to see leave office, but not over Monicagate. I absolutely do not believe that the current issues are impeachable.

<<But your above comment assumes that all Clinton support is just partisan rhetoric>>

Mostly correct. I was probably overstating the case, but as the rest of my post makes clear, the attempts at justification by both sides are finally getting to me. We need to discuss the real issues, none of which are related to Clinton's policies - I am saying that to both sides, not just the Democrats.

<<If so why can't Star or any one else prove it?>>

IMHO, they have. Travelgate was fairly well documented by a Democrat led committee and by the court that exonerated Billy Dale. The problem is, no one was punished for it. No one was fired, no one was fined, nothing was done, even though that committee found that the FBI and the IRS were used to dig up dirt on Billy Dale and the other members of the travel office, and that the direction to do so came from Hillary. The problem is, Hillary doesn't hold an elective office, and there hasn't been any way to hold BC responsible for Hillary's actions, even though Nixon was held responsible for the actions of his subordinates.

Filegate has also been well documented, and shows a clear abuse of the privacy laws as well as FBI procedures.

I've never seen the evidence disputed, but I've also not seen any action taken. Since the action would have to come from Janet Reno, I guess that should come as no surprise to me. That's why I favor a hearing on these issues as part of these proceedings. If it turns out the evidence is false, I'll be right up here apologizing.
